WebOldTownPress • 4 yr. ago. It depends on the beanie material and finish. If it's a thick fuzzy knit, you probably won't have great results. If it's not so fuzzy and has a smoother finish, … WebAug 2, 2024 · Htv on acrylic blanks. What kind of vinyl is used for hats? Note: For hats, I recommend glitter iron-on or flocked heat transfer vinyl.I didn’t go over any seams with …

WebSince acrylic is heat sensitive, it is a good idea to use a Cap Heat Press to ensure that only the area on the platen is exposed to the heat. We threaded the beanie to the platen to ensure that only the half of the apparel that we are customizing is exposed to the heat.
